    • 147,269. McKenzie, Holland, & Westinghouse Power Signal Co., and Proud, H. M. April 14, 1919. Lamp-failure warning-devices.- The operation of a switch, controlling two lamps or other indicating- devices, is indicated at the distant control station through the operation of a relay included in the lamp circuit. The relay is provided with a polarized armature and an unpolarized armature interconnected to indicate direction and cessation of current. The armatures 2, 3 of the controlling relay 1, Fig. 1, place the lamp 9 and an indicating relay 4 in series across a battery 11 when in the positions shown, and in their lower position place the lamp 10 and relay 4 in series across the battery 11 in such a manner that the current through the relay 4 is reversed. The relay 4 is provided with an unpolarized armature 12 and a polarized armature 13, by means of which the direction of the current through the relay or the cessation of the current is indicated at the, distant station. In the modification shown in Fig. 2, the battery 11 is placed in the common return circuit of the lamps 9, 10. In a further modification, the positions of the relay 4 and the battery 11 shown in Fig. 2 are interchanged. In the modification shown in Fig. 4, the battery 11, Fig. 2, is replaced by the secondary winding 14 of a transformer 15, while a transformer 17 is placed between the armatures 2, 3 and one winding 18 of the relay 4. A second winding 19 is energized continuously with alternating current.

    • 113,615. McKenzie, Holland, & Westinghouse Power Signal Co., (Assignees of Holliday, J. S.). Feb. 20, 1917, [Convention date]. Electrical systems, automatic. - Relates to a relay comprising a magnetic structure in two parts, each having four pole-pieces a, b, c, d and a , b , c , d , opposite one another, leaving a narrow gap in which a conducting-vane V is mounted on, a pivot so that it is free to swing upwards and close a circuit by means of the tail piece Y, Fig. 4. Each part of the magnetic structure is provided with a winding L located on the vertical limb between the two inner polepieces and a second winding T embracing the two inner pole-pieces. Each winding is connected in series with the companion winding on the other magnetic part. For controlling the signals on an insulated section 10 of railway track, the windings L are connected to an alternating-current generator G, the track is connected to the generator through a transformer 13 the secondary of which contains a reactance 14 which produces a displacement of phase of the current taken from the track by the windings T in relation to the current in the windings L. The signal S is held at " clear " when no train is on the section by the action of the two magnetic fluxes relatively displaced in phase, which raise the vane and close a local signal-operating circuit at K. When a train is on the section the cons Tare short-circuited, the vane falls and the local circuit is broken, and the signal moves to " danger."
